
Structural Analysis Engineer – Aerospace

This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in United States.
• Utilize engineering mechanics and physics-based analysis techniques to assess system performance and inform design choices
• Conduct structural evaluations utilizing classical hand calculations, finite element analysis, and simulation methods
• Examine components and assemblies for strength, stiffness, fatigue life, fracture resistance, and overall structural integrity
• Assist in the development of requirements and ensure that designs meet customer, program, and regulatory standards
• Collaborate with cross-functional engineering teams to address technical challenges and enhance product performance
• Evaluate designs, analyses, and verification processes to offer independent technical assessments and suggestions
• Create technical reports, compliance documentation, and presentations to convey analysis findings and engineering justifications
• Aid in qualification, verification, and validation efforts throughout the product development lifecycle
• Contribute to the establishment of internal engineering standards, best practices, training resources, and process enhancements
• Take ownership of technical deliverables while advancing projects in a collaborative team setting
•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, or a related technical field
• 4–7 years of experience in aerospace, defense, or other highly regulated engineering sectors
• Proficiency in applying structural mechanics, dynamics, kinematics, and physics-based modeling techniques
• Strong expertise in finite element analysis, structural simulation, and engineering verification methodologies
• Required experience with SolidWorks
• Familiarity with FEMAP, NASTRAN, LS-DYNA, Python, and Microsoft Office
• Experience in requirements-driven environments with compliance, regulatory, and verification obligations
• Solid understanding of engineering principles and analytical and computational techniques
• Proven ownership, initiative, accountability, interpersonal, and communication abilities
• CATIA V5 experience is preferred
• Background in pressurized actuation systems, pneumatic mechanisms, ordnance systems, or similar hardware is preferred
• Experience in the aerospace industry is preferred; candidates from other regulated sectors will also be considered
• Only US Persons (citizens or permanent residents) are eligible to apply
• Successful completion of a pre-employment drug screening is required as a condition of hire
